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Extraction

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Be aware of the following signs and take action quickly to prevent further dam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ore musty odors in your ceiling, as they can be a sign of mold growth. If left unchecked, mold can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Act quickly if you notice water stains or discoloration on your ceiling. These can be signs of a leak or water damage that needs immediate attention.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Don’t delay if you notice peeling paint or wallpaper on your ceiling. These can be signs of water damage or high humidity that needs professional attention.

Visible Water Damage

Don’t wait if you notice visible water damage on your ceiling, such as warping, buckling, or sagging. This can be a sign of a serious issue that needs immediate attention.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Be aware of unusual noises or sounds coming from your ceiling, such as creaking, groaning, or dripping. These can be signs of water damage or a structural issue that needs professional attention.

High Humidity or Moisture

Don’t ignore high humidity or moisture levels in your home, as they can lead to mold growth and water damage. If left unchecked, these issues can cause serious health problems and costly repairs.

Ceiling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ain (less than 1 square foot) Yes No DIY is fine for small stains, but be sure to dry the area completely to prevent further damage.
Visible water damage (buckling, warping, or sagging) No Yes Visible water dam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health risks.
High humidity or moisture levels No Yes High humidity or moisture levels can lead to mold growth and water damage, making it essential to call a professional for help.
Large water extraction job (more than 10 feet of affected area) No Yes Large water extraction jobs need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ure the job is done safely and effectively.
Emergency situation (burst pipe, roof leak, etc.) No Yes In emergency situations, call a professional immediately to prevent further damage and health risks.
Existing mold growth or mildew No Yes Existing mold growth or mildew needs professional attention to ensure the issue is resolved safely and effectively.

Ceiling Water Extraction Cost In McMinnville, TN

The cost of ceiling water extraction in McMinnville, TN,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Get a free estimate to find out the cost of your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small water stain removal (less than 1 square foot) $100 – $500 Size of stain, type of material affected
Visible water damage repair (less than 10 feet of affected area) $500 – $2,500 Size of damage, type of material affected, equipment needed
Large water extraction job (more than 10 feet of affected area) $2,500 – $10,000 Size of job, equipment needed, number of technicians required
Emergency situation response (burst pipe, roof leak, etc.)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of situation, number of technicians required, equipment needed
Existing mold growth or mildew removal $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of material affected, equipment needed

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to find out the cost of your specific situation.

Common Questions About Ceiling Water Extraction

Do I need to call a professional for ceiling water extraction?

Yes, it’s highly recommended to call a professional for ceiling water extraction, especially if you’re dealing with a large amount of water or visible damage. A professional will have the necessary equipment and expertise to ensure the job is done safely and effectively.

How long does ceiling water extraction take?

The length of time it takes to complete ceiling water extraction dep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ete the job.

What equipment is used for ceiling water extraction?

Our team uses specialized equipment, such as water extractors, pumps, and indust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ers, to ensure the job is done efficiently and effectively.

Is ceiling water extraction covered by insurance?

Yes, ceiling water extraction may be covered by insurance, depending on the circumstances.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and help you navigate the insurance process.

Can I prevent ceiling water damage from happening again?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ent ceiling water damage from happening again. Regular maintenance, such as inspecting your roof and gutters, can help prevent water damage and ensure your home remains in good condition.
